A MAN charged with larceny from the person was granted $30,000 bail yesterday, after Police reported that the stolen item has been recovered.
Police Corporal Munilall Seetaram, prosecuting, told Acting Chief Magistrate Melissa Robertson-Ogle that the gold chain worth $35,000, belonging to Nedege Rodney, is lodged at Brickdam Station.
The defendant, Ian Peters, 23, of Lot 22 Belfield, East Coast Demerara, pleaded not guilty to stealing it on April 18.
Peters claimed he was at home sleeping when Police arrested him for something he knows nothing about.
He has to be back in Court on May 11.
